Key Responsibilities
The successful candidate will be responsible for conducting thorough receiving inspections of mechanical materials, verifying vendor documentation, and cross-checking construction drawings and reports before inspection. Coordination with contractor material teams, project management teams, and process and instrumentation departments is essential to oversee proper material receiving inspection activities.
Additional duties include assisting QA/QC management personnel, supervising quality control actions on materials, executing witness inspections and tests as per the Inspection and Test Plan (ITP), and ensuring adherence to all technical requirements and local regulations.
Required Skills and Experience
- Minimum of 5 years’ experience in relevant industries such as oil and gas or petrochemical sectors.
- At least 3 years specifically working as a Mechanical Material Receiving Inspector on ARAMCO project sites with EPC contractors.
- In-depth knowledge of international codes and standards including ASTM, API, IEC, NEMA, UL, FM, NFPA, ASME BPVC (Sections I, V, VIII, IX), ANSI/ASME B31.3, B31.4, B31.8, B73, API 620, API 650, AWS D1.1, and NACE standards.
- Proficiency with the 2015 ISO 9001 quality management system standards and a strong understanding of engineering drawings, standards, material specifications, construction methods, and quality inspection processes.
- Ability to perform detailed document reviews, inspections, and testing with minimal supervision to ensure contractor compliance.
